Definitions:

Job Cost Sheets

Documents that track the direct materials, direct labor, and manufacturing overhead for a specific job in a manufacturing process.

Time Tickets

Documents used to record the amount of time an employee spends on various tasks, often used for payroll or job costing.

Direct Labor

The wages and related benefits of employees who are directly involved in the production of goods or services.

Materials Requisition

The process of requesting and withdrawing materials from inventory for use in the production process or for other operational needs.
